2. Strategic Gamification Design

Leveraging insights from behavioral psychology and game theory, we design bespoke gamification strategies. This includes selecting appropriate game mechanics (points, badges, leaderboards, narratives) that resonate with your users and drive desired behaviors, from increased engagement to skill acquisition. Our designs focus on intrinsic and extrinsic motivators, ensuring long-term participation and a positive user experience. We prototype and iterate on these designs to refine the mechanics before full-scale development.

3. AI-Powered Optimization

Neural networks are integrated to personalize the gamified experience. This allows for adaptive difficulty, tailored content delivery, and predictive analytics on user behavior. AI helps in continuously optimizing the system for effectiveness, identifying patterns, and suggesting improvements to maximize engagement, learning, and ultimately, income generation. This data-driven approach ensures the gamified system evolves and remains effective over time, adapting to changing user preferences and business needs.

Project Minerva: AI-Powered Corporate Training

Developed a gamified e-learning platform for a Fortune 500 company, incorporating adaptive AI to personalize training modules. Resulted in a 30% reduction in onboarding time and a 45% increase in knowledge retention among new hires. The system dynamically adjusted content difficulty based on individual performance, ensuring optimal learning curves.

Project EngageFlow: E-commerce Revenue Boost

Implemented a gamification layer for an online retail client, introducing loyalty points, daily challenges, and achievement badges. This led to a 15% increase in average order value and a 25% rise in repeat customer purchases within six months. The system used machine learning to predict optimal reward timings.
